1 Chronicles 4:13 Meaning and Commentary

1 Chronicles 4:13

And the sons of Kenaz
Who was either the son of Chelub, or of Eshton:

Othniel, and Seraiah;
the first of these is he who is mentioned, ( Joshua 15:17 ) ( Judges 1:13 ) ( 3:9 ) and was the first judge in Israel:

and the son of Othniel, Hathath;
and the next mentioned.

1 Chronicles 4:13 In-Context

11 Kelub, Shuhah's brother, had Mehir; Mehir had Eshton;
12 Eshton had Beth Rapha, Paseah, and Tehinnah, who founded Ir Nahash (City of Smiths). These were known as the men of Recah.
13 The sons of Kenaz: Othniel and Seraiah. The sons of Othniel: Hathath and Meonothai.
14 Meonothai had Ophrah; Seraiah had Joab, the founder of Ge Harashim (Colony of Artisans).
15 The sons of Caleb son of Jephunneh: Iru, Elah, and Naam. The son of Elah: Kenaz.
